From what I have seen of Bentley the past few seasons I am not a huge fan however and can see him being another passenger that we feel we have to play because of his profile. barton in the middle drops far too deep though and we end up playing with two DM's, albeit with one that can pass over 20 yards. maybe with ben arfa and carroll up top to hold the ball that wouldnt be so bad, but it doesnt work with the options we've got up top currently. In our current style of play you're better off having Nolan alongside Tiote rather than Barton. We're very "direct" in our style (long ball merchants tbh) so when you're playing that way it makes more sense to have Nolan in the team because he'll get forward and score a few goals and get on the end of knockdowns from balls forward. Put someone like Ben Arfa (or anyone with any sort of class on the ball, really) up top alongside Carroll and then maybe there'd be some benefit to having Barton alongside Tiote, as he's far more willing to drop deep and bring the ball out from deep than Nolan is. Of course, the problem is that he's not fantastic in that role, his passing is a bit too hit and miss for him to really impose himself on a game, but if you're looking to build a better "footballing" side then you'd have Barton in the middle of Nolan. The problem with that at the moment is that we've nobody that fits the bill to play off Carroll and our wingers aren't exactly top class either. Personally think Barton has been a revelation out wide and I'd play him there full time if it were up to me. Then find someone better than Jonas to play on the left and a ball playing CM to play alongside Tiote and you'd have the makings of a useful front 6, IMO.
